Tracy Zhou
6d8afb2187
Allow two finger gesture from trackpad to pull down notification from home
...
Fixes: 255602235
Test: manual
Change-Id: I99742320b322a1e7b04bad0e374fcc48f8871ce1
2022-10-25 19:03:52 +00:00
Holly Jiuyu Sun
ba1c20d2a3
Merge "Log a-z apps count." into tm-qpr-dev am: 381ba3319d am: 52cebe3a69
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20029946
Change-Id: I1e8520025c91510c711cd378431b51e281a8048c
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 18:17:12 +00:00
Schneider Victor-tulias
9274de0695
Merge "Remove obsolete cancel recents animation logic" into tm-qpr-dev am: 4c9a93c04f am: 536f3ede15
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20272754
Change-Id: I79eaf811072f56feba6befcdfa53a22baa4453dc
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 18:17:02 +00:00
Holly Jiuyu Sun
52cebe3a69
Merge "Log a-z apps count." into tm-qpr-dev am: 381ba3319d
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20029946
Change-Id: Iedca65de9f046fba4d3d4595970adeb0f4ebc24f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 18:14:39 +00:00
Holly Jiuyu Sun
381ba3319d
Merge "Log a-z apps count." into tm-qpr-dev
2022-10-25 17:50:19 +00:00
Schneider Victor-tulias
536f3ede15
Merge "Remove obsolete cancel recents animation logic" into tm-qpr-dev am: 4c9a93c04f
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20272754
Change-Id: Iff0729ff836ed1648ebf488af2c0f840a3d97b98
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 17:40:27 +00:00
Schneider Victor-tulias
4c9a93c04f
Merge "Remove obsolete cancel recents animation logic" into tm-qpr-dev
2022-10-25 17:02:29 +00:00
Andras Kloczl
fb65436fae
Improve All Set page UI for large screens
...
Test: manual
Screenrecordings: https://drive.google.com/drive/folders/1S6kjenZn0kP-W2tPpUemre2x0368ACyr?usp=sharing
Bug: 233610579
Change-Id: I9a33efe193a96e752766feb1e91cf0ac9b30246f
2022-10-25 13:16:47 +00:00
Tony Huang
65af7f8c07
Merge "Snapshot 2 tasks when swipe up split case" into tm-qpr-dev am: c33c69c1c3 am: 54d58c1f1a
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20223761
Change-Id: Ifa616ab224472c537b29f4c51503af57155e8a00
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 07:13:37 +00:00
Tony Huang
54d58c1f1a
Merge "Snapshot 2 tasks when swipe up split case" into tm-qpr-dev am: c33c69c1c3
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20223761
Change-Id: I974373c26c8e48283287ea4954e08ee4b74959d1
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 06:17:56 +00:00
Tony Huang
c33c69c1c3
Merge "Snapshot 2 tasks when swipe up split case" into tm-qpr-dev
2022-10-25 05:42:39 +00:00
Sihua Ma
af210f70fd
Merge "Get rid of setInteractionHandler call to the host in launcher" into tm-qpr-dev am: 4421353ce8 am: 82eba8a3bf
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20274922
Change-Id: I1c6327a673d0444d317d5983255c80d2b823d596
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 04:01:22 +00:00
Sihua Ma
82eba8a3bf
Merge "Get rid of setInteractionHandler call to the host in launcher" into tm-qpr-dev am: 4421353ce8
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20274922
Change-Id: Ib5219481f120ed86021b59c80509303bd1073f97
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-25 03:25:37 +00:00
Sihua Ma
4421353ce8
Merge "Get rid of setInteractionHandler call to the host in launcher" into tm-qpr-dev
2022-10-25 02:44:16 +00:00
Wei Sheng Shih
65aa338ab6
Merge "Fixs NPE when start back-to-home animation."
2022-10-25 02:07:45 +00:00
Tracy Zhou
6445fc9102
Merge "Support swipe gesture on trackpad to swipe up from app"
2022-10-25 01:41:54 +00:00
Sunny Goyal
97ae16e80c
Updating AIDL interface and removing unused methods
...
Bug: 193244407
Test: Presubmit
Change-Id: If87ef08e16e541921cde4e7a15a675b07c388fef
2022-10-24 15:50:25 -07:00
Saumya Prakash
96cad794d7
Removed disabled overview actions at end of scroll
...
Updated visibility of the overview action bar so that when viewing
the clear all button at the end of the tasks it becomes hidden.
Previously, the overview actions were disabled so they were not
usable anyways. Updated the corresponding tests because expected
behavior was changed.
Test: Manual
Fix: 230508197
Change-Id: I17628f1fa3869b575ec404a2a630a6927e3c1d14
2022-10-24 22:47:24 +00:00
Sihua Ma
8ca56fe1cd
Get rid of setInteractionHandler call to the host in launcher
...
Bug: 235358918
Test: N/A
Change-Id: I0defac1831825bf0a13a601dd1502b4ca022bc2e
2022-10-24 14:56:11 -07:00
TreeHugger Robot
b4977f4f38
Merge "Removing unnecessary RemoteAnimationTargetCompat" into tm-qpr-dev am: b9bced07c2
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20239831
Change-Id: I435e09e315997ed9ac0cdf3e691a6573371a7ce6
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-24 21:43:02 +00:00
Sunny Goyal
d859060860
Merging MultiValueAlpha with MultiPropertyFactory
...
Bug: 246644619
Test: Presubmi
Change-Id: Id5abc5f3169544656f1139ae17ca59e34ac65dac
2022-10-24 14:38:18 -07:00
TreeHugger Robot
b9bced07c2
Merge "Removing unnecessary RemoteAnimationTargetCompat" into tm-qpr-dev
2022-10-24 21:32:34 +00:00
Ats Jenk
7344ff6306
Merge "Clicking on desktop tile brings apps to front" into tm-qpr-dev am: 1236c812f1 am: a8dcda1d7b
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20249369
Change-Id: Ib009395ff5ba90d8fdc25e5b8f054a65a0c1bfa6
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-24 21:29:31 +00:00
Ats Jenk
a8dcda1d7b
Merge "Clicking on desktop tile brings apps to front" into tm-qpr-dev am: 1236c812f1
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20249369
Change-Id: I1f1e327666da267638ae98d5f4fd56b935072a88
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-24 21:24:57 +00:00
Ats Jenk
1236c812f1
Merge "Clicking on desktop tile brings apps to front" into tm-qpr-dev
2022-10-24 20:57:25 +00:00
Mady Mellor
344a5974cd
Merge "Hide launcher when freeform tasks are visible" into tm-qpr-dev am: b5c2565447 am: f602559b25
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20017950
Change-Id: Ie285233ddb6e8bf53c1482c7385a04b9629519b3
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-24 18:04:24 +00:00
Jeremy Sim
0525e3a462
Add transitions to DWB banner when app thumbnail progresses from Overview tile to fullscreen
...
This patch makes it so that the DWB banner transitions out neatly when a user in Overview drags a tile downward to launch the app. Previously, the banner would stick around throughout the transition, creating visual clutter and drawing attention to the corners of the app.
Fixed by creating an exit transition in setFullscreenProgress(), similar to other UI elements like Overview action chips.
There is another outstanding issue where sometimes the transition can get clipped and jump to the final frame. The cause is still unknown, but issue is tracked at b/250976138 for a future fix.
Fixes: 249825524
Test: Manual
Change-Id: Iea47a9bc643537f0b716ce11b104803d9ca25fd2
2022-10-24 10:47:29 -07:00
Mady Mellor
f602559b25
Merge "Hide launcher when freeform tasks are visible" into tm-qpr-dev am: b5c2565447
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20017950
Change-Id: I1605450eac52bed58566c55259246009c59b27b5
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-24 17:21:45 +00:00
Sunny Goyal
8a11443333
Removing unnecessary RemoteAnimationTargetCompat
...
Merged-In: I12a4c29eaf9bd7d97d3c02074b4cc1ca452fc88a
Bug: 221961069
Test: Presubmit
Change-Id: I12a4c29eaf9bd7d97d3c02074b4cc1ca452fc88a
2022-10-24 17:17:36 +00:00
Sunny Goyal
0d77cd7166
Merge "Removing unnecessary RemoteAnimationTargetCompat"
2022-10-24 17:16:49 +00:00
Schneider Victor-tulias
0130252c00
Remove obsolete cancel recents animation logic
...
This logic was used as a workaroung for 2-button navigation mode. This mode is now obsolete, however the leftover logic clashes with gesture navigation mode. Removed old logic and unused variables.
Test: manually tapped nav handle, then quickly swipped up
Fixes: 255348258
Change-Id: Ib4e179c0c4d9769acae24f93cfde65d2c7a4dfd9
2022-10-24 10:12:45 -07:00
Mady Mellor
b5c2565447
Merge "Hide launcher when freeform tasks are visible" into tm-qpr-dev
2022-10-24 16:04:59 +00:00
wilsonshih
0988afc44e
Fixs NPE when start back-to-home animation.
...
Animation target should get from parameter.
Bug: 238475284
Test: build/flash, monitor launcher won't crash while start
back-to-home animation
Change-Id: I7bd254a436ddcf250d90827b9d81d628bcd4313c
2022-10-24 22:36:23 +08:00
Shan Huang
2b6c7f8b0c
Merge "Use spring-y progress in back to home animation."
2022-10-22 13:47:14 +00:00
Tracy Zhou
daad3fefea
Support swipe gesture on trackpad to swipe up from app
...
Bug: 254783214
Test: https://recall.googleplex.com/projects/3388b17c-d22f-46f8-b140-a102690377b4/sessions/92d385dd-bad5-49ea-a0b4-b4bf4010aabb
Change-Id: I74ba4a9e5c5096aaf6475f9cb8f1dc30de48024d
2022-10-22 07:18:16 +00:00
Shan Huang
deee3c1a46
DO NOT MERGE Use spring-y progress in back to home animation. am: f31bf4e1e3
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20123116
Change-Id: I926c3b4e4f20a740c29337459228859018bc5e1b
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-22 00:11:52 +00:00
Shan Huang
e3279da4fc
Merge "DO NOT MERGE Use spring-y progress in back to home animation." into tm-qpr-dev
2022-10-21 23:54:12 +00:00
Shan Huang
09465d5070
Use spring-y progress in back to home animation.
...
Bug: 241788651
Test: m -j. Visual inspection.
Change-Id: Ia003136b17fb8e0a383768ccc3c0fcf4ca4cadeb
2022-10-21 15:40:28 -07:00
Shan Huang
f31bf4e1e3
DO NOT MERGE Use spring-y progress in back to home animation.
...
Bug: 241788651
Test: m -j. Visual inspection.
Change-Id: If2b0218367680853ae4ee89c5ecff224ab9b6f04
2022-10-21 22:14:38 +00:00
Vinit Nayak
fef51c7628
Merge "Use updateButtonLayoutSpacing() for all states" into tm-qpr-dev am: cb26c1a245 am: 812bb6604d
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20247867
Change-Id: Ib97b1cce072bcd58f32ba18817c498d533d6b57f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 21:31:59 +00:00
Vinit Nayak
812bb6604d
Merge "Use updateButtonLayoutSpacing() for all states" into tm-qpr-dev am: cb26c1a245
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20247867
Change-Id: Ifbb6aff2ede81eff756128c7b2b35612bee6d86d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 21:00:14 +00:00
Vinit Nayak
cb26c1a245
Merge "Use updateButtonLayoutSpacing() for all states" into tm-qpr-dev
2022-10-21 20:32:10 +00:00
Sunny Goyal
2e0bdd4f49
Merge "Optimizing some icon generation code:" into tm-qpr-dev am: 415fe0c183 am: ef188e8c23
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20040405
Change-Id: Ia9595c728b3ab46b8530a689598bb6cc7c433477
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 20:04:34 +00:00
Sunny Goyal
ef188e8c23
Merge "Optimizing some icon generation code:" into tm-qpr-dev am: 415fe0c183
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20040405
Change-Id: Id325662e61d5cdcc625923536a8458eb44fdd9b9
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 19:17:35 +00:00
Schneider Victor-tulias
ee0bc03d58
Decrease TAPL All Apps scrolling flakiness
...
scrolling in all apps did not factor in additional top padding in the all apps list recycler. This made it so that apps could occasionally scroll and be obcured by that top padding, making them un-tappable. Added this padding to the scrolling logic to make scrolling less flaky.
Test: TaplTestsTaskbar, TaplTestsLauncher3 and presubmit
Fixes: 248064856
Change-Id: Id76b92b4bc354917f3688ac53673d0ed7a905f02
2022-10-21 12:12:38 -07:00
Sunny Goyal
415fe0c183
Merge "Optimizing some icon generation code:" into tm-qpr-dev
2022-10-21 18:27:54 +00:00
Mady Mellor
9a90c2d521
Hide launcher when freeform tasks are visible
...
This CL introduces a new controller to manage the visibility of the
launcher workspace when desktop mode is active and freeform tasks
are visible.
This controller will be notified when the sysui state flag related
to freeform task visibility is changed.
The controller will modify the workspace visibility as well as
the flags on the activity indicating if it's been paused / resumed
based on freeform tasks being visible or not.
Bug: 245569277
Test: manual - enable desktop mode and open some freeform tasks
=> observe that the contents of launcher is hidden and
taskbar shows
- remove all of the freeform tasks
=> observe that the contents of launcher reappears along
with the hotseat.
Change-Id: I378ab97b40cbb954a06f4e2426b195efddad905c
2022-10-21 10:06:54 -07:00
Vinit Nayak
2a2fbfe319
Use updateButtonLayoutSpacing() for all states
...
* During a merge conflict we prevented
updateButtonLayoutSpacing() from running if device was
in setup mode, however the code that does setup layout
is in there.
Fixes: 254589281
Test: Went through setup, back button shows up
where expected
Change-Id: Ib496bfc0e3ac9023a9fc5071867c3779721ab8ab
2022-10-20 23:11:33 -07:00
Vinit Nayak
61d94834f7
Merge "Improve TaskMenuView layouts for split pairs" into tm-qpr-dev am: b9b7c38d55 am: 05e238ff32
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20169868
Change-Id: I5c1a164b627794f1f25007ce467bd33bcc26c84f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 01:16:27 +00:00
Vinit Nayak
05e238ff32
Merge "Improve TaskMenuView layouts for split pairs" into tm-qpr-dev am: b9b7c38d55
...
Original change: https://googleplex-android-review.googlesource.com/c/platform/packages/apps/Launcher3/+/20169868
Change-Id: I2d4308adb3a6396732b663a2f05e9af115318261
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2022-10-21 00:43:22 +00:00